Plugins that previously computed cutoff times from store-local timezones must remove that logic entirely; duplicating it will cause double-enforcement and rejected orders near the boundary. Instead, read the cutoff fields from the order context object, which the platform populates at request time. Timezone conversion, holiday exceptions, and grace periods are all handled upstream now. Your plugin should treat these values as read-only. The authoritative cutoff configuration is shown below.

settings of kawig-kahip:
ULAETH_PIN=4988
ULAETH_TENANT=briath
ULAETH_METRICS_HOST=metrics.ulaeth.xolmarworks.test
ULAETH_SEAL=seal_e1a2fe42
ULAETH_STANDBY_TEAM=pelix

Spokeshift is our bike-share rebalancing tool. It assigns vans to move bikes between over- and under-stocked docks in the Tarnwick network. Support handles rider-facing complaints only; routing errors, stuck van assignments, and stale dock counts go to the rebalancing team. For those escalations, email the team inbox below.

escalation mailbox, hadug-bajog: sormir@norvalabs.internal

Handover: I finished migrating the Lumenkit booking flow to locale-aware date rendering. All hardcoded MM/DD strings are gone; we now use the FormatWell helper with the tenant's locale from session context. Watch for the edge case where Quillhaven tenants override week-start days — there's a unit test covering it. Tamsin reviewed the parser changes already, so focus your review on the template layer. The full locale mapping table is documented on the internal page here:

runbook for badug-kadup: https://confluence.zemvarlabs.internal/projects/browse/display/projects/bd1b

Subject: DR drill — checkout load test, Thursday

Plugin authors: we're replaying peak traffic against the Cartholm checkout sandbox Thursday. Expect throttling and forced failovers. Keep your plugins pointed at the drill endpoint only. If your plugin loses its drill credentials during failover, restore them with the recovery passphrase below.

unlock words, yawig-kagef: gordor-holvan-ulaael-pramir-ulaiel-tamdor